I'm a 4-foot fashionista taking the runway by storm — I've never let my short stature hold me back
“I want to break the barriers down for all the little people out there to follow their dreams," the native New Yorker said.

Glory Quinonez, 33, a native New Yorker who was born with a bone growth disorder called achondroplasia dwarfism, felt like she was "born to be a model" despite the relentless bullying as a child.
